Muhammad Yunus, Nobel Peace Prize recipient and founder of the Grameen Bank, recognized that while New York City was the capital of banking, it also held one of the most significant disparities between rich and poor. In 2008, he opened the doors of Grameen America, a replication of the Grameen Bank in Bangladesh. Whole Planet Foundation was one of the early supporters of Grameen America’s lending operations in New York City, providing a $150,000 grant over three years to support low-income entrepreneurs in Queens, New York.
